By Type

Stick-built:

The stick-built type of aluminum curtain walls is characterized by its traditional construction approach, where individual components are assembled on-site. This method allows for greater flexibility in design and is often favored for custom projects that require unique specifications. Stick-built systems typically involve the use of vertical and horizontal framing members that are fabricated off-site and then transported to the construction site for assembly. This approach can be time-consuming and labor-intensive, which may increase overall project costs. However, it provides the advantage of on-site adjustments, making it suitable for complex architectural designs. The demand for stick-built curtain walls is driven by their adaptability, particularly in renovations and retrofits of existing structures in urban areas.

Unitized:

Unitized aluminum curtain walls are pre-fabricated modules that are constructed off-site and assembled into larger wall sections before being transported to the site for installation. This system significantly reduces on-site labor and construction time, thereby improving overall efficiency and minimizing weather-related delays. Unitized systems are popular for high-rise buildings due to their ability to maintain quality control during manufacturing and facilitate quicker installation. Furthermore, unitized walls come with enhanced thermal and sound insulation properties, making them an attractive option for modern construction projects. The increasing trend of modular construction and the need for efficient building processes are driving the growth of the unitized aluminum curtain wall segment.

Semi-unitized:

Semi-unitized curtain walls combine elements of both stick-built and unitized construction methods. This system involves assembling parts of the curtain wall, such as frames and infill panels, off-site, while allowing for some degree of on-site assembly. The semi-unitized approach provides a balance between customization and efficiency, making it suitable for buildings requiring specific design elements while still benefiting from reduced labor costs and installation times. The flexibility inherent in semi-unitized systems attracts developers and architects seeking solutions that accommodate unique architectural features while maintaining a streamlined construction process. As the market moves towards hybrid construction methods, the demand for semi-unitized curtain walls is expected to grow.

Spider System:

The spider system is a specialized type of aluminum curtain wall characterized by its unique structural support, which utilizes stainless steel components to connect glass panels to the main frame. This system allows for large expanses of glass to be used, achieving a modern and sleek aesthetic that is highly desirable in contemporary architecture. Spider systems are particularly popular in high-visibility commercial spaces like shopping malls and airports, where maximizing natural light and external views is paramount. The design flexibility offered by spider systems, along with their structural integrity, makes them an appealing choice for architects focused on creating iconic facades. Additionally, the rising trend of using glass as a primary building material is expected to drive the adoption of spider systems in various construction projects.

Custom:

Custom aluminum curtain walls are designed and fabricated to meet specific project requirements, often incorporating unique design elements and advanced materials. This type of curtain wall allows architects and developers to push the boundaries of design, accommodating complex shapes, sizes, and configurations that standard systems cannot achieve. The custom segment is particularly prominent in high-end commercial and institutional buildings, where aesthetic considerations are paramount. As clients increasingly seek distinctive architectural features, the demand for custom aluminum curtain wall solutions is expected to rise. Additionally, advancements in technology and manufacturing processes are making it easier and more cost-effective to produce custom solutions, thus enhancing their market appeal.

By Function

Aesthetic:

The aesthetic function of aluminum curtain walls is one of the primary reasons for their widespread adoption in modern architecture. These systems allow architects to create striking facades that enhance the visual appeal of buildings through the use of large glass panels and innovative designs. The versatility of aluminum enables a wide range of finishes and colors, allowing for creative expression that can align with the architectural vision of any project. Aesthetically pleasing aluminum curtain walls can significantly impact the first impression of a building, contributing to its marketability and desirability. As the emphasis on design continues to grow, the demand for visually appealing curtain walls is expected to rise, driving this segment's growth.

Structural:

The structural function of aluminum curtain walls is critical for ensuring the integrity and safety of the buildings they are installed in. These systems are engineered to withstand various environmental forces, including wind loads, seismic activity, and temperature fluctuations. The lightweight nature of aluminum, combined with its strength, allows for the construction of expansive facades without compromising structural stability. Additionally, advancements in engineering and materials science are leading to the development of curtain walls that provide enhanced load-bearing capabilities. As safety regulations become increasingly stringent, the importance of robust structural performance in aluminum curtain walls will continue to drive demand within this segment.

Weatherproofing:

Weatherproofing is a key functional aspect of aluminum curtain walls, as they are designed to protect buildings from external elements such as rain, wind, and snow. The ability of these systems to provide effective weather resistance contributes to energy efficiency and the longevity of the structure. High-quality sealing technologies integrated into aluminum curtain walls ensure that air and water infiltration is minimized, creating a comfortable indoor environment. As climate change leads to more extreme weather events, the need for reliable weatherproofing solutions becomes even more critical. Consequently, the demand for aluminum curtain walls that excel in weather resistance is expected to grow, particularly in regions prone to harsh weather conditions.

Solar Control:

Solar control is another important function of aluminum curtain walls, as they can be designed to manage natural light and heat entering a building. This feature is particularly essential in regions with high levels of sunlight, where excessive heat gain can lead to increased energy consumption for cooling. By incorporating advanced glazing options and shading devices within the curtain wall design, architects can optimize solar control to enhance occupant comfort while reducing energy costs. The growing emphasis on energy efficiency and sustainable building practices is further driving the demand for aluminum curtain walls that incorporate solar control technologies, making it an essential segment of the market.

Others:

The "Others" category encompasses various additional functions that aluminum curtain walls can serve, such as acoustic insulation, fire resistance, and security features. These aspects are increasingly important in specific applications, such as commercial buildings and public facilities, where noise control and safety are paramount. The integration of advanced technologies and materials into aluminum curtain walls allows for improved performance in these areas, catering to the unique needs of different projects. As building codes and regulations continue to evolve, the demand for multifunctional aluminum curtain walls that address a wider range of requirements is expected to increase, highlighting the growing versatility of these systems.

Threats

Despite the positive outlook for the aluminum curtain wall market, certain threats could impact its growth trajectory. One of the primary challenges is the volatile nature of raw material prices, particularly aluminum. Fluctuations in the cost of aluminum due to changes in trade policies, supply chain disruptions, or global economic conditions can affect profit margins for manufacturers and lead to increased prices for end-users. Additionally, competition from alternative materials, such as glass and stone, presents a challenge as architects and developers explore various options for building facades. These materials may offer unique aesthetic or performance advantages that could detract from the appeal of aluminum curtain walls if manufacturers do not continuously innovate and improve their products.

Another significant threat is the potential for regulatory changes that could impact construction practices and building codes. As environmental concerns grow, governments may implement stricter regulations regarding energy efficiency, sustainability, and emissions in the construction industry. While this can drive demand for energy-efficient aluminum curtain walls, it can also create challenges for manufacturers who need to adapt their products and processes to comply with new standards. Staying abreast of regulatory changes and proactively addressing them will be crucial for companies operating in the aluminum curtain wall market to maintain their competitiveness and profitability.
